Porticate Procession

Share

After staying for one month in Yunquera, the Virgen Chiquita (Small Virgin) is taken back to Porticate, where they held Mass and spend the day eating and having fun until sunset.

Halfway down the road, Virgin Mary gets a locally made jasmine garland around her neck and a bunch of grapes at her feet.

How to get here

The most advisable route to Yunquera starts at the city of Málaga. Take the A-357 highway towards Campillos. After about 14 kilometres, you will get to Cártama, and immediately after that village, you must take the A-355 to Coín. From that locality, you must continue by way of the A-366 to Alozaina. (This is the same road as the A-355 but this stretch has a different name.) At Alozaina, continue on the same road to Yunquera.

If you start from Ronda, you should take the A-366 too, but towards Málaga. You will come to El Burgo after about 25 kilometres and to Yunquera 9 kilometres farther along.
